15 Smart SEO Strategies to Increase Organic Sales

1. Perform Ecommerce Keyword Research

Every successful SEO campaign begins with understanding what customers are searching for.

Target Purchase-Intent Keywords

Examples include:

  • Buy Running Shoes Online
  • Best Gaming Laptop
  • Wireless Earbuds Under ₹5000
  • Organic Face Wash
  • Bluetooth Speaker Online

These keywords often indicate strong buying intent.

Use Long-Tail Keywords

Examples:

  • Best Office Chair for Back Pain
  • Waterproof Hiking Shoes for Men
  • Cotton T-Shirts for Summer
  • DSLR Camera Under ₹60000

Long-tail keywords generally have lower competition and can attract highly qualified shoppers.

2. Optimize Product Pages

Product pages are among the most important assets of an e-commerce website.

Write Unique Product Descriptions

Avoid copying manufacturer descriptions.

Instead, include:

  • Product overview
  • Key features
  • Benefits
  • Technical specifications
  • FAQs
  • Usage tips

Original content improves both SEO and user experience.

Optimize Metadata

Each product page should have:

  • Unique SEO Title
  • Meta Description
  • URL
  • H1 Heading
  • Image ALT text

Optimized metadata helps search engines understand your products more effectively.

3. Optimize Category Pages

Category pages often target broader, high-volume keywords.

Create SEO-Friendly Categories

Examples:

  • Men’s Shoes
  • Smartphones
  • Kitchen Appliances
  • Office Furniture
  • Home Decor

Category pages should include descriptive introductory content rather than only product listings.

Improve User Navigation

Use:

  • Filters
  • Sorting options
  • Breadcrumb navigation
  • Internal links
  • Clear category descriptions

Good navigation improves both usability and crawlability.

4. Improve Website Speed

Page speed directly affects user experience and conversions.

Optimize Performance

Improve loading speed by:

  • Compressing product images
  • Using lazy loading
  • Optimizing CSS & JavaScript
  • Browser caching
  • Using a CDN
  • Choosing reliable hosting

Faster websites reduce bounce rates and improve customer satisfaction.

Monitor Core Web Vitals

Track:

  • Largest Contentful Paint (LCP)
  • Interaction to Next Paint (INP)
  • Cumulative Layout Shift (CLS)

Strong Core Web Vitals contribute to a better user experience.

9. Implement Product Schema Markup

Structured data helps search engines understand your product pages and can improve how they appear in search results.

Use Product Schema

Implement structured data for:

  • Product name
  • Brand
  • Price
  • Availability
  • SKU
  • Product images
  • Ratings
  • Reviews

When implemented correctly, eligible pages may display rich results such as prices, ratings, and stock availability.

Validate Your Schema

Use Google’s Rich Results Test or Schema Markup Validator to ensure your structured data is error-free and follows current guidelines.

11. Optimize the Checkout Experience

Driving traffic is only valuable if visitors complete their purchases.

Reduce Cart Abandonment

Improve the checkout process by:

  • Offering guest checkout
  • Minimizing form fields
  • Showing shipping costs early
  • Supporting multiple payment methods
  • Displaying trust badges

A simpler checkout experience often leads to higher conversion rates.

Common Ecommerce SEO Mistakes

Using Duplicate Product Descriptions

Copying manufacturer descriptions across product pages reduces uniqueness and can make it harder for search engines to understand the value of your content.

Ignoring Category Pages

Many stores focus only on product pages. Well-optimized category pages often target broader, high-volume keywords and can generate significant traffic.

Slow Website Performance

Large images, unnecessary scripts, and poor hosting can slow your store and negatively affect both user experience and conversions.

Poor Internal Linking

Without strategic internal links, users and search engines may struggle to discover important products and categories.

Not Updating Out-of-Stock Products

Leaving outdated product pages without clear stock information can frustrate users. Update inventory regularly and suggest relevant alternatives when products are unavailable.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does Ecommerce SEO take to show results?

Many online stores begin seeing measurable SEO improvements within 3–6 months, although timelines depend on competition, website authority, product catalog size, and the consistency of optimization efforts.

Is Product Schema important for Ecommerce SEO?

Yes. Product schema helps search engines understand product information and may enable eligible pages to display rich results such as prices, ratings, and availability in Google Search.

Can SEO increase online sales?

Yes. A well-executed SEO strategy can attract qualified shoppers who are actively searching for products. Sales results depend on factors such as product demand, pricing, user experience, website trust, and conversion optimization.

Should every product have a unique page?

Absolutely. Every product should have its own dedicated page with unique descriptions, specifications, images, FAQs, and optimized metadata.

Why are category pages important for Ecommerce SEO?

Category pages target broader keywords, improve site architecture, help users discover products, and often become major sources of organic traffic.
